Embracing Loss and Grief: Individual Counseling Support

Loss and grief are deeply personal experiences that can touch individuals in unique ways. When facing the loss of a loved one, or dealing with other significant life changes, it's common to encounter a range of intense emotions such as sadness, anger, guilt, and confusion. Exploring individual counseling support can provide a valuable space to process these feelings in a safe and nurturing environment.

A qualified therapist can offer personalized guidance and tools to help you heal. Through support, you can learn meaningful coping mechanisms, gain clarity into your grief journey, and build strategies for navigating life's challenges.

It's important to remember that there is no right or wrong way to grieve. Allow yourself the time and space you need to process. Individual counseling can be a powerful resource to support your journey through loss and grief.

Finding Focus and Fulfillment: Adult ADHD Therapy Navigating

Adult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) can present unique challenges across everyday life. Tasks that seem simple to others can feel overwhelming, and maintaining focus and motivation can be a constant struggle. Luckily, there are effective approaches available to help adults with ADHD prosper. Therapy provides a supportive space to explore the nuances of your ADHD, learn coping mechanisms, and develop personalized strategies for success.

Finding the right therapist is crucial. Look for someone who specializes in ADHD and employs evidence-based methods. With the right support, you can harness your strengths and build a fulfilling life despite the challenges of ADHD.
